Snow is clear, but it appears white … WebOct 21, 2024 · Unsurprisingly, snow crab like cold water. Snow crab support valuable fisheries in the frigid waters of the eastern Bering Sea and North Atlantic. But how cold snow crab need their habitat to be changes over the course of a crab’s life. Immature snow crab live in colder waters; as they mature, they migrate to slightly warmer habitat. Web64-79 cm. Length. 70 cm.
